Transaction 8251249746a10388f67d61f1122e8db88bd16f801bfe8d6831e971f9386aeeb0
1 Input
1 Output
-
8251249746a10388f67d61f1122e8db88bd16f801bfe8d6831e971f9386aeeb0:0
- value
- 610536
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ecaca6f16212e12ab3e9fdd6861e6683fa40b1e6
- address
- bc1qajk2dutzztsj4vlflhtgv8nxs0aypv0xv6wygy